LOGAN — One day after the man he snaps it to was named to the Maxwell Award Watch List, Utah State center Tyler Larsen was named to the 2013 Dave Rimington Trophy Fall Watch List.

This is the third straight year the senior from Jordan High School has been named to the watch list. The Rimington Trophy is awarded to the Most Outstanding Center in College Football. Larsen was previously named as a preseason fourth-team All-American by Phil Steele.

Five other players from the Mountain West Conference are on the 44-player list: Hawaii's Ben Clarke, Nevada's Matt Galas, UNLV's Robert Waterman and New Mexico's Dillon Farrell. Larsen is also the only center from the state to be named to the list.

Larsen joins former Aggies Brent Deladurantey (2005) and Ryan Tonnemacher (2007) that have been named to the list. Larsen, however, is the only Aggie to have been named three times.

Larsen enters his senior season having started 38 consecutive games, the longest active streak in the Mountain West and tied for the fifth-longest active streak in the nation.
